Traditional use:
Myrrh is used in traditional herbal medicine for mild inflammation of the mucous membranes of the mouth and throat as well as for the external treatment of small wounds and ulcers.In cosmetics:
The CO2-extracted essential oil of myrrh is often used in perfumes because of its characteristic aromatic, balsamic, warm, smoky and slightly musty and earthy odor profile.

Technical Details & Test Data
- Production
By supercritical fluid extraction with natural carbon dioxide, no solvent residues, no inorganic salts, no heavy metals, no reproducible microorganisms.
